> I am running a playbook to update an existing AWS Autoscaling group and
> have started to encounter an error message that I was not seeing before.
>
> Environment:
>
> Amazon Linux
>
> Python 2.7.10
>
> ansible (2.0.0.2)
>
> boto (2.38.0)
>
> botocore (1.3.20)
>
>
>
> running the playbook to update an existing autoscaling group, I started
> getting this error last week:
>
>
> TASK [Update Autoscaling Group]
> ************************************************
>
> task path: /opt/hephaestus/ansible/tasks/update-asg.yaml:13
>
> ESTABLISH LOCAL CONNECTION FOR USER: root
>
> localhost EXEC ( umask 22 && mkdir -p "$( echo
> $HOME/.ansible/tmp/ansible-tmp-1453161674.67-268535195031737 )" && echo "$(
> echo $HOME/.ansible/tmp/ansible-tmp-1453161674.67-268535195031737 )" )
>
> localhost PUT /tmp/tmpSYEg2V TO /root/.ansible/tmp/ansible-tmp-
> 1453161674.67-268535195031737/ec2_asg
>
> localhost EXEC LANG=en_US.UTF-8 LC_ALL=en_US.UTF-8 LC_MESSAGES=en_US.UTF-8
> /usr/bin/python /root/.ansible/tmp/ansible-tmp-1453161674.67-
> 268535195031737/ec2_asg; rm -rf
> "/root/.ansible/tmp/ansible-tmp-1453161674.67-268535195031737/" > /dev/
> null 2>&1
>
> An exception occurred during task execution. The full traceback is:
>
> Traceback (most recent call last):
>
>  File
> "/root/.ansible/tmp/ansible-tmp-1453161674.67-268535195031737/ec2_asg",
> line 2998, in <module>
>
>    main()
>
>  File
> "/root/.ansible/tmp/ansible-tmp-1453161674.67-268535195031737/ec2_asg",
> line 2987, in main
>
>    create_changed, asg_properties=create_autoscaling_group(connection,
> module)
>
>  File
> "/root/.ansible/tmp/ansible-tmp-1453161674.67-268535195031737/ec2_asg",
> line 2664, in create_autoscaling_group
>
>    wait_for_elb(connection, module, group_name)
>
>  File
> "/root/.ansible/tmp/ansible-tmp-1453161674.67-268535195031737/ec2_asg",
> line 2526, in wait_for_elb
>
>    healthy_instances = elb_healthy(asg_connection, elb_connection, module,
> group_name)
>
>  File
> "/root/.ansible/tmp/ansible-tmp-1453161674.67-268535195031737/ec2_asg",
> line 2500, in elb_healthy
>
>    except boto.exception.InvalidInstance, e:
>
> AttributeError: 'module' object has no attribute 'InvalidInstance'
>
>
> fatal: [localhost]: FAILED! => {"changed": false, "failed": true,
> "invocation": {"module_name": "ec2_asg"}, "parsed": false}
>
>
>
>
> I have tried to change the version of boto and ansible, however the error
> now persists. I have not been able to identify any root cause or known bug
> other than the error message. I have tried switching a few options on and
> off in the playbook such as: wait_for_instances and lc_check.
